I have received an offer from University of Bath for computer information systems. I have applied for computer science at Lancaster, Leicester, Queen Mary, Sussex. I was not eligible to study pure computer science at Bath because I do not have Maths A-Level.
I visited the university and really loved the area, it's everything I want in a university, only, after I did some independent research, I found that computer information systems is not the most respectable degree to have. I know that Bath is a very respectable university, and I doubt that they would provide a course which is not respectable, but I could be wrong.
What does everybody think about a computer information systems degree? I thought that perhaps because I don't have the maths A-level, that this would be a better choice for me in terms of difficulty, but if my other choices did not ask for Maths A-Level, the maths can't be too difficult.
Could I have some advice to shape my decision?
